Friendship House balances being business like with social objectives. This means any surplus income is reinvested into the organisation to help us achieve our vision. The beneficiary of any surplus made is the community we serve.

Friendship House is in the city centre of the Manukau business district. We have connections with people locally, regionally, nationally and internationally. We function as a clearing house for information particularly through the Counties Manukau area and especially in relation to social and community services.
